The Salty Sunflower Nature Collaborative is a nature-based education community rooted in the landscapes of San Diego—its beaches, canyons, and open spaces.

We are a connected ecosystem of learning experiences for children, families, and educators, offering a 9-month nature school program, seasonal outdoor camps, drop-off play days and date nights, and a platform for independent educators to design and lead their own nature-based learning programs.

We believe children grow through connection—to nature, to community, and to meaningful lived experience. Our programs nurture curiosity, resilience, emotional awareness, and a deep sense of belonging in the natural world.

We honor neurodiversity and individual learning pathways, creating inclusive environments where children are supported as whole people and development is guided through relationship, exploration, and experience.

A Different Kind of Learning Community

Salty Sunflower is not a traditional preschool, camp, or enrichment program.

It is a nature-based learning community where children, families, and educators engage in meaningful outdoor experiences that support development through connection, curiosity, and lived experience.

  • Learning here is not built around classrooms, worksheets, or rigid academic structure.

    Instead, it unfolds in real environments—beaches, canyons, trails, and open spaces—where children learn through movement, exploration, observation, and relationship with the natural world.

  • We center learning that is:

    • Grounded in outdoor, play-based exploration

    • Responsive to children’s emotional and developmental needs

    • Built through relationships, not instruction alone

    • Flexible, seasonal, and experience-driven

    • Inclusive of different learning styles and neurodiversity

    • Connected to family and community participation

  • Across our programs, children may experience:

    • Guided nature exploration and open-ended play

    • Time in beaches, canyons, and natural ecosystems

    • Storytelling, movement, and sensory-based learning

    • Social-emotional development through group experience

    • Opportunities for families to participate in shared learning moments

    Educators are not delivering a fixed curriculum—they are designing and facilitating living experiences shaped by place, season, and group dynamics.

This is a living learning ecosystem.

It grows through the environment, the children, the families, and the educators who are part of it.

Seasonal Camps & Play Days

Flexible, short-form outdoor experiences for children and families to explore nature, build connection, and engage in seasonal, play-based learning.

  • Immersive 2–5 day seasonal camps exploring beaches, canyons, and local ecosystems through play and discovery

  • Drop-in Play Days in outdoor, sensory-rich environments featuring potion making, water play, and nature-based creative stations

  • Parent-child nature experiences, including outdoor cooking and shared hands-on learning in nature

  • Consistent rhythm of exploration, making, open play, and reflection grounded in natural settings

  • Small group environments that prioritize curiosity, connection, and emotional safety
